polycrystal; polycrystalline
Technical term used in materials science and crystallography. As a noun, refers to a solid composed of many small crystals. As a no-adjective, describes something consisting of multiple crystals.
Polycrystalline silicon is widely used in solar cells.
This material has a polycrystalline structure.
polycrystalline
Compound of 多 (many) and 結晶 (crystal). A straightforward technical term.
